Bonjour
voici mon code
extrait de mon fichier
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40 while ( getline( fsrc, ligne ) ) {lst = Utilities::Split(ligne,'=',false); list<string>::iterator iter = lst.begin(); if (*iter++ == "archive_jini") { int pos = ligne.find("frmwebutil.jar"); if (pos == -1) ligne.append(",frmwebutil.jar"); pos = ligne.find("jacob.jar"); if (pos == -1) ligne.append(",jacob.jar"); cout << ligne << endl; } else if (*iter++ == "archive") { int pos = ligne.find("frmwebutil.jar"); if (pos == -1) ligne.append(",frmwebutil.jar"); pos = ligne.find("jacob.jar"); if (pos == -1) ligne.append(",jacob.jar"); cout << ligne << endl; } else if (*iter++ == "WebUtilArchive" ) { int pos = ligne.find("frmwebutil.jar"); if (pos == -1) ligne.append("/forms/java/frmwebutil.jar"); else { pos = ligne.find("/forms/java/frmwebutil.jar"); if (pos == -1) ligne = Utilities::Remplace (ligne, "frmwebutil.jar", "/forms/java/frmwebutil.jar"); } pos = ligne.find("jacob.jar"); if (pos == -1) ligne.append("/forms/java/jacob.jar"); else { pos = ligne.find("/forms/java/jacob.jar"); if (pos == -1) ligne = Utilities::Remplace (ligne, "jacob.jar", "/forms/java/jacob.jar"); } cout << ligne << endl; } }
mon souci c'est que la variable ligne affiche toujours la meme valeur# Forms applet parameter
serverApp=default
# Forms applet archive setting for JInitiator
archive_jini=frmall_jinit.jar
# Forms applet archive setting for other clients (Sun Java Plugin, Appletviewer, etc)
archive=frmall.jar
# Number of times client should retry if a network failure occurs. You should
# only change this after reading the documentation.
networkRetries=0
# Page displayed to Netscape users to allow them to download Oracle JInitiator.
# Oracle JInitiator is used with Windows clients.
# If you create your own page, you should set this parameter to point to it.
jinit_download_page=/forms/jinitiator/us/jinit_download.htm
# Parameter related to the version of JInitiator
jinit_classid=clsid:CAFECAFE-0013-0001-0022-ABCDEFABCDEF
# Parameter related to the version of JInitiator
jinit_exename=jinit.exe#Version=1,3,1,22
# Parameter related to the version of JInitiator
jinit_mimetype=application/x-jinit-applet;version=1.3.1.22
# DS but not AS and is also available for download from OTN.
[webutil]
WebUtilArchive=frmwebutil.jar,jacob.jar
WebUtilLogging=off
WebUtilLoggingDetail=normal
Merci de m'aider
Partager